Output dfd71d8b17341053c76e4ac4709330da032538c75061144a25de1a57397f829b:137

value
15314028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a882f2a3dbf5cf7cfe08c5fb3626d5fcf297158 OP_EQUAL
address
3CruWCCHWeKhVgcKC6FcQnzYyeWDwY4d6F
transaction
dfd71d8b17341053c76e4ac4709330da032538c75061144a25de1a57397f829b
spent
true